Summary

Pomona Elementary is a K-6 public school serving 264 students in Costa Mesa within the Newport-Mesa Unified district, notable for serving a community where over 94% of students qualify for free or reduced-price lunch.

Academically, the school faces significant challenges, with proficiency rates in English (41.55%), Math (27.27%), and Science (11.36%) well below the district average, resulting in a statewide ranking in the 38th percentile. However, the school receives substantial resources to support its students, with per-student funding of $28,505—higher than nearby schools like Heinz Kaiser Elementary ($24,387) and Newport Heights Elementary ($24,744)—and maintains a favorable student-teacher ratio of 16.7 to 1. Chronic absenteeism, while improved from pandemic highs, remains an area for focus at 13.7%.

The school's context is defined by stark contrasts within its own district, where high-poverty schools like Pomona, Whittier Elementary, and Wilson Elementary coexist with more affluent, higher-performing schools, highlighting a wide achievement gap. Performance varies greatly by grade level within Pomona, and year-to-year rankings have been volatile. A positive trend is the steady improvement in student attendance, which may support future academic gains if it continues.
